加入收藏 | 设为首页 | 会员中心 | 我要投稿 百科站长网 (https://www.baikewang.com.cn/)- AI硬件、建站、图像技术、AI行业应用、智能营销!
当前位置: 首页 > 教程 > 正文

编解码系统设计与实战进阶指南

发布时间:2026-02-13 14:00:22 所属栏目:教程 来源:DaWei
导读:  编解码系统是现代信息技术中不可或缺的一部分,广泛应用于数据传输、存储和处理等领域。简单来说,编解码就是将数据从一种形式转换为另一种形式的过程,编码是将原始数据转化为特定格式,解码则是将其还原。  

  编解码系统是现代信息技术中不可或缺的一部分,广泛应用于数据传输、存储和处理等领域。简单来说,编解码就是将数据从一种形式转换为另一种形式的过程,编码是将原始数据转化为特定格式,解码则是将其还原。


  在设计编解码系统时,需要考虑多个关键因素,包括数据的结构、传输效率、错误检测与纠正能力等。例如,在网络通信中,常用的编解码方式有Base64、UTF-8、JSON、XML等,每种都有其适用场景和优缺点。


  实际应用中,编解码系统的性能直接影响整体系统的效率。因此,选择合适的编解码算法至关重要。对于大数据量的处理,应优先考虑高效且压缩率高的编码方式,如二进制协议或自定义协议。


  实战中,开发人员通常会结合具体需求进行定制化设计。例如,在实时音视频传输中,采用H.264或H.265等编解码标准,可以有效降低带宽消耗并提升传输质量。同时,还需要注意兼容性和扩展性,确保系统能够适应未来的变化。


  测试与优化也是编解码系统设计的重要环节。通过模拟不同场景下的数据流,验证系统的稳定性和准确性,并根据反馈进行调整。使用工具对编解码过程进行性能分析,有助于发现瓶颈并优化代码。


2026AI生成的视觉方案,仅供参考

  在实际项目中,团队协作和文档记录同样不可忽视。清晰的接口定义和详细的实现说明,能够帮助后续维护和功能扩展。同时,遵循统一的编码规范,也有助于提高代码质量和可读性。


  站长个人见解,编解码系统的设计与实现是一项复杂但富有挑战性的任务。通过合理的选择、细致的规划和持续的优化,可以构建出高效、可靠的编解码解决方案,满足多样化的业务需求。

(编辑:百科站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章